Fractional Ownership in Commercial Property: Yields, Risks & Opportunities

By Bijesing RajputFeb 24, 2026
Share:

Fractional ownership in commercial property allows multiple investors to jointly own a high-value real estate asset, such as an office tower, retail mall, or warehouse, by purchasing a fraction of it. Instead of investing crores in a single property, investors can contribute smaller amounts starting from ₹10–25 lakh and enjoy rental income, capital appreciation, and shared ownership rights. This model is increasingly popular in India, offering NRIs, professionals, and retail investors access to premium commercial real estate that was once reserved for institutional players.

What exactly is fractional ownership in commercial property?

Fractional ownership is a model where multiple investors collectively own a commercial property, each holding a legal share proportionate to their investment.

This model works like buying shares in a company, but applied to real estate. Each investor earns a share of rental income and future appreciation. In India, fractional ownership is usually managed through platforms or Special Purpose Vehicles (SPVs) that ensure compliance, property management, and revenue distribution.

Key features include:

  • Lower entry ticket (₹10–25 lakh vs. ₹10+ crore for full property).
  • Shared rental yields (6–10% annually in India, 2025).
  • Diversification across multiple properties.
  • Professional property management by the platform.

Why is fractional ownership gaining popularity in India?

Fractional ownership has gained momentum due to rising commercial property prices and evolving investor behaviour.

In 2025, Grade-A office spaces in Mumbai, Delhi-NCR, and Bengaluru average ₹20,000–₹40,000 per sq. ft., putting direct ownership beyond reach for most retail investors. Fractional ownership bridges this gap, enabling participation in high-performing commercial markets.

Reasons for popularity:

  • High entry barrier reduced: Retail investors can now access premium properties.
  • Attractive yields: Commercial rental yields in India (2025) average 7–9%, higher than residential (2–3%).
  • NRI demand: Dollar returns on Indian commercial real estate remain strong.
  • Tech-enabled platforms: Transparent dashboards, digital contracts, and hassle-free management.

How does fractional ownership work in practice?

Fractional ownership is structured through platforms that pool investor funds into an SPV or LLP, which then purchases the commercial property.

Investors receive units or shares in the SPV, representing ownership. Rental income is distributed quarterly or monthly, and upon sale, capital gains are shared proportionally.

Process:

  1. Investors browse curated commercial assets on the platform.
  2. Minimum investment is set (₹10–25 lakh).
  3. Funds are pooled via SPV/LLP.
  4. Rental income flows directly to investor accounts.
  5. Exit is possible after lock-in or secondary sale.

What are the benefits of fractional ownership in commercial property?

Fractional ownership offers accessibility and wealth-building opportunities for retail investors.

Direct benefits include:

  • Lower Capital Requirement: Entry from ₹10–25 lakh.
  • Steady Income: Yields of 6–10% per annum.
  • Diversification: Invest in offices, warehouses, and retail assets across cities.
  • Professional Management: No hassle of tenant acquisition or maintenance.
  • Liquidity Option: Exit through secondary markets or after lock-in.

Comparison – Residential vs. Fractional Commercial Investment:

Factor Residential Property Fractional Commercial Property
Entry Price ₹40–80 lakh (metro) ₹10–25 lakh
Rental Yield 2–3% 6–10%
Management Self-managed Professionally managed
Liquidity Low Moderate–High
NRI Demand Medium High

What risks should investors consider?

While fractional ownership opens doors, it also carries risks investors must evaluate.

Key risks include:

  • Liquidity constraints: The Secondary resale market is still evolving in India.
  • Platform dependency: Returns depend on the credibility of the platform.
  • Property risk: Vacancy, tenant default, or market downturns may impact yields.
  • Regulatory clarity: SEBI has issued guidelines, but full regulation is still developing.

Tip: Always choose SEBI-registered platforms and verify property grade before investing.

What returns can investors expect?

Fractional ownership returns are driven by rental yields + capital appreciation.

  • Rental yields: 6–10% annually across Indian metros.
  • Capital appreciation: 3–6% annually, depending on location and demand.
  • Overall ROI potential: 9–14% per annum (average).

Sample Data Table – 2025 Rental Yields (Grade-A Commercial):

City Rental Yield Avg. Property Price (₹/sq. ft.)
Mumbai 6.5–8% 25,000–40,000
Bengaluru 7–9% 18,000–28,000
Delhi-NCR 7–8% 20,000–30,000
Hyderabad 8–10% 15,000–25,000
Pune 7–8.5% 14,000–22,000

Who should consider fractional ownership?

Fractional ownership suits investors looking for stable returns, portfolio diversification, and exposure to premium commercial markets.

Ideal profiles include:

  • NRIs seeking rupee appreciation and dollar-adjusted rental yields.
  • Retail investors with ₹10–25 lakh capital.
  • Professionals who want passive income without managing tenants.
  • HNI/Ultra HNI investors seeking diversification beyond equities and gold.

Key Takeaways

  • Enables access to premium commercial real estate with just ₹10–25 lakh.
  • Yields of 6–10% annually + capital appreciation of 3–6%.
  • Ideal for NRIs, retail investors, and professionals seeking passive income.
  • Risks include liquidity, platform dependency, and market downturns.
  • Best chosen through SEBI-regulated platforms with Grade-A properties.

Conclusion

Fractional ownership in commercial property is transforming India’s real estate investment landscape in 2025. By lowering entry barriers and providing access to Grade-A assets, it empowers retail investors, NRIs, and professionals to enjoy stable rental yields and long-term wealth creation. However, like any investment, it requires due diligence, platform credibility checks, and risk assessment.
